The base tower shouldn't shoot anyone. If they get to your base, it's because they are using higher cost units that don't give as much income. Right now, the only viable strategy is to build newbies until you max their population limit, then switch to samurai, then heavy armor men etc... The only way to counterbalance this is to make each tier of units cost the same so that you aren't penalized for properly countering the enemies units. As long as my horde of recruits can mass in front of my tower while the enemy is destroyed by the tower, I can wait for the opportune moment that I can overwhelm my opponent's tower. Even once you hit the 8k income cap, the same strategy applies. How little money can you use to save up enough for an overwhelming force. The tower doing dmg, or as much dmg, only leaves 1 viable strategy.
